#6def77 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#6def77 is composed of 42.7% red, 93.7% green and 46.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 54.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 50.2%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 124.6 degrees, a saturation of 80.2% and a lightness of 68.2%. #6def77 color hex could be obtained by blending #daffee with #00df00. Closest websafe color is: #66ff66.

Shades and Tints of #6def77

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010d02 is the darkest color, while #fafefb is the lightest one.

Tones of #6def77

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#abb1ac is the less saturated color, while #61fb6c is the most saturated one.
